Evidence-based approaches and online care that fit your life

Kimberly uses evidence-based therapeutic techniques aimed at real problems. One common approach focuses on teaching practical coping skills for anxiety and panic - breathing and grounding strategies, stepwise exposure to fears, and small behavioral experiments to test assumptions. This work helps reduce intense bursts of fear and builds confidence in everyday situations.

Another frequently used method addresses mood and motivation by breaking tasks into manageable steps and changing unhelpful thinking patterns. That approach helps with low mood, self-esteem, and problems like rumination or guilt. It also supports work on relationships, communication problems, and attachment concerns through clear exercises and role-based practice.

Choosing the right approach is part of the work together. Kimberly will listen to your goals, try methods that fit your preferences, and adjust the plan as you progress. The process is collaborative and paced to your needs.

Online sessions offer practical flexibility. Video calls are useful for deeper conversation and visual cues. Phone sessions work when you need lower bandwidth or prefer not to be on camera. Live chat and text messaging allow shorter check-ins and tracking progress between sessions. These options make it easier to fit therapy into a busy life while keeping consistent momentum.
